Description
The Thousand Winds promo card, designated as 58s in the Khans of Tarkir Promos set, stands as a distinctive entry in the Magic: The Gathering trading card game catalog. Released in 2014, this card captures the strategic depth associated with the Khans of Tarkir block, offering collectors a piece of that era's design history. As a rare foil print, it appeals to enthusiasts who value both the aesthetic finish and the mechanical complexity of the release. This creature card is classified as an Elemental with a mana cost of four generic and two blue mana symbols, resulting in a mana value of six. The card features the power and toughness of 5/6, providing a substantial presence on the battlefield. Its design includes the flying keyword, allowing it to bypass ground-based blockers, and the versatile morph ability. Collectors appreciate morph for its strategic flexibility, enabling players to cast the card face down as a 2/2 creature for three mana and later reveal its true form. The morph mechanic triggers a powerful effect when the creature is turned face up: it returns all other tapped creatures to their owners' hands. This ability makes the card a compelling choice for set builders and those interested in the intricate rules interactions of the Khans of Tarkir Promos series. The card was illustrated by Raymond Swanland, whose work contributes to the visual identity of the 2014 release.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Flying Morph {5}{U}{U} (You may cast this card face down as a 2/2 creature for {3}. Turn it face up any time for its morph cost.) When this creature is turned face up, return all other tapped creatures to their owners' hands.
